Re: [flexcoders] My website Project
Hello, You can use the following two options to load rest of the features of your application. 1. Modules 2. RSL (Runtime Shared Libraries) Both of the aforementioned techniques will load the components only when they are used instead of loading them on main application initialization. Re: AW: [flexcoders] Rich Text Editor
If you start with a simple one-line editor without rich. You can do this: 1. create text field instance (set dynamic, disable selectable, editable) 2. create your own caret cursor (simple drawing api) 3. create your own canvas instance (for the selection rectangle) 4. catch the keydown-events (to handle left, right keys, and to update the text etc.) 5. catch mousedown-event (to reposition the caret) 6. handle the selection yourself (caret position, selection start, selection end) 7. write method to resolve a x,y position to the character index (e.g that caret position ;)) 8. write method to resolve x,y position from a character index (to position to caret correctly) 9. write method to move the caret to this position Really easy! Second step would be to support multiline in a similar matter and then support richtext... Yours, Weyert

RE: [flexcoders] headless mode
You can create and work with display objects, including Flex UIComponents, without adding them to the display list, so they are in memory only not on the screen. Or you can add them to the display but set visible=false. [flexcoders] Re: Any way to version a swf with major and minor
Hey everyone, first post here. The other day I posted this to flashcoders, doesn't seem like too many were interested, so I'll try here: Ola, I thought some of you might be interested in this. Before starting a little Actionscript project in FB, I installed git, the newest craze in source version control. I saw a bunch of netizens freaking out about it all over the place, and the ability to create branches effortlessly and to back up things easily appealed to me. So after a relatively painless install on my Mac, I had it going in the Terminal. I then started to experiment in FB. I created an Actionscript project, and then started a git repository in that folder (using basically only these commands: http://www.kernel.org/pub/software/scm/git/docs/everyday.html -- Individual Developer (Standalone)). I wrote the basic engine for the swf and then created a new branch for guiing up this engine. At this point I saw the power in this approach. Basically, when I switch from the engine branch to the GUI branch, the AS code is updated in FB, quickly and correctly, which I sort of expected. But not only that, all the external assets are then loaded into the project. Furthermore as long as I keep committing changes to branches at important intervals, or new branches for new approaches/ideas, I have a complete annotated history of the project. I can load in any code at any point I committed and keep dead ends that might prove useful in some other project, or redo the gui for another swf some other day, and everything, including images and even compiled swfs, are loaded in as well. Dirt cheap and easy. I don't know, this is freaking me out, it is so good.
